I. Dofollow Links: The Golden Ticket to Authority
- What are dofollow links? A dofollow link is a standard link that passes "link juice" — the value and authority from the linking page—to the linked page. Think of it as a vote of confidence.
- Why Dofollow Links Matter: Dofollow links from high-authority, relevant websites signal to search engines that your content is credible and worth ranking highly. This can result in:
- Increased Search Visibility: Gaining high-quality dofollow backlinks can improve your website's ranking for targeted keywords and attract more organic traffic.
- Enhanced Brand Authority: A robust backlink profile strengthens your brand's reputation and positions your website as a valuable resource.
- Targeted Traffic Growth: Referrals from authoritative websites often lead to qualified traffic more likely to engage with your content and convert into customers.
II. Nofollow Links: Strategic Control and Transparency
- What are nofollow links? A nofollow link is a link that tells search engines not to pass along the linking page's authority to the target page. It's used for various reasons:
- Paid Advertisements: Using nofollow for sponsored links avoids the risk of search engines misinterpreting them as organic endorsements.
- User-Generated Content: Marking user-submitted content links (comments, forums, guest posts) as nofollow maintains a more natural-looking link profile.
- Untrusted Links: Using nofollow for potentially spammy or low-quality sites helps protect your website's reputation.
- Strategic Application of Nofollow: Using nofollow strategically allows you to control and shape how search engines perceive your link profile. A balanced mix of dofollow and nofollow links is generally preferred.

IV. Technical Implementation and Considerations:
- The rel="nofollow" HTML Tag: The rel="nofollow" attribute is crucial for telling search engines not to follow a link. It's implemented directly within the anchor tag (<a>). Use it whenever you want to prevent the transfer of link equity.
- <a href="https://example.com/" rel="nofollow">Example Link</a>

CMS-Specific Guidelines:
Different Content Management Systems (CMS) handle nofollow attributes differently. Here are some common examples:
- WordPress: Plugins like Yoast SEO or Rank Math simplify adding the rel="nofollow" attribute. These plugins often have options to automatically nofollow certain links (e.g., comments). Manual editing of the HTML code within your posts or pages is also an option for adding the attribute directly.
- Wix/Squarespace/Shopify: These platforms often have built-in link settings, but manual HTML editing might be necessary for more complex scenarios. Consult the platform's documentation for detailed instructions.

- Analyze Link Attributes:
- "nofollow" Attribute: Determine whether the link should be "nofollowed" to prevent passing PageRank or to avoid potential penalties.
- "sponsored" Attribute: Use the "sponsored" attribute for paid links or links received in exchange for compensation.
- "UGC" Attribute: Use the "UGC" attribute for user-generated content, such as comments or forum posts.
